acu-3Isocitrate lyase; Catalyzes the formation of succinate and glyoxylate from isocitrate, a key step of the glyoxylate cycle, which operates as an anaplerotic route for replenishing the tricarboxylic acid cycle. Required for growth on ethanol or acetate, but dispensable when fermentable carbon sources are available. Acts also on 2- methylisocitrate; Belongs to the isocitrate lyase/PEP mutase superfamily. Isocitrate lyase family. (548 aa)
